Sleeps 8 Luxury Park Models
Our most luxurious rental — a fully-equipped tiny home that sleeps eight.
One private bedroom with a queen, two sleeping lofts, and a double sofa bed. You'll have your own full kitchen with a residential refrigerator and stove/oven, a bathroom with a large shower, a living room with sofa and recliner, flat-screen TVs, heat, A/C, and a sliding patio door to your private deck. Two queen bedding sets and two towel sets are included.
The Cabins
Each cabin comes with a fridge, microwave, flat-screen TV with cable, ceiling fan, and electrical outlets — plus a private picnic table and fire ring at your site. Bring your own linens and pillows. (Cabins share our modern comfort stations; smoking and pets aren't permitted.)

Bring Your Own
From full-hookup pads built for the biggest rigs to a wooded tent grove above the lake — and budget-friendly overflow fields when you just want to get out here.
Water, 15/30/50-amp electric, sewer, cable TV, and a concrete pad. Easy access for the biggest rigs with open-sky satellite views.
Full-service sites with water, electric (some 50-amp), sewer, and cable TV, plus picnic table and fire ring.
A wooded grove overlooking the lake, with shared fire rings and picnic tables. Bring a long extension cord and settle in.
Our most economical, priced per person. Open camping with comfort stations close by — the budget-friendly way to get out here.
Big-rig friendly with detailed driving directions available. Need storage between visits? RV & tent storage is just $15/week, with optional RV valet for $8/move. See rates & services →
